Financial Advisor Salary in Rowlett, TX: $84,915 (2026)

Quick Answer:A full-time financial advisor in Rowlett, TX earns a median $84,915/year (≈ $40.82/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 13-2052). Once you factor in Rowlett's price level (4% below national, BEA RPP 96.0), that paycheck buys what $88,453 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 2.0% below the Texas state average.

Financial Advisor Job Market in Rowlett

Financial advisors in Rowlett are operating within a unique job market, characterized by the employment of 15 professionals in this niche. The cost of living index at 96 suggests that while living expenses are manageable, they remain below the national average, which impacts a financial advisor's take-home purchasing power. Among employers, wirehouses such as Morgan Stanley and Merrill Lynch typically offer the highest compensation packages, but independent broker-dealers like LPL and fee-only Registered Investment Advisors (RIAs) are gaining prominence. The pay scale variation largely emerges from factors such as client asset volume, fee structures, and advisor credentials like CFP or CFA, with those working at RIAs often benefiting from higher rates due to fiduciary responsibilities. For those looking to enhance their earnings in Rowlett, focusing on building a robust client base and obtaining high-value credentials will be critical in this evolving market.
